The Advanced Skill Certificate in Materials for Smart Sensors equips participants with in-depth knowledge of materials science principles crucial for the design and fabrication of next-generation sensors. This intensive program focuses on the selection and characterization of materials exhibiting unique properties for various sensing applications.
Learning outcomes include a comprehensive understanding of material properties influencing sensor performance, proficiency in materials characterization techniques like SEM and XRD, and expertise in designing and fabricating prototypes of smart sensors using cutting-edge materials. Graduates will be adept at analyzing sensor data and interpreting results.
The program's duration is typically 12 weeks, delivered through a blend of online and potentially in-person modules, depending on the specific program structure. This flexible format allows professionals to upskill or reskill while balancing work and personal commitments. The curriculum covers nanomaterials, polymers, and 2D materials for sensor applications.
